Fragagnano

Fragagnano ( in the local dialect: Fragnànu ) is a Southeast Italian commune ( comune ) with 5345 inhabitants ( 31 December 2012) in the province of Taranto in Apulia. The village is located approximately 20.5 km west-southwest of Tarentum in Salento. Fragagnano part of the Unione di comuni " Terre del Mare e del Sole", an amalgamation of several municipalities in the eastern part of the province of Taranto.

Traffic

Through the village, Main Road 7ter Appian leads coming from Taranto to Lecce.
